Polands Corner Neighborhood Market Intelligence

Overview

Polands Corner is a residential neighborhood located in the western part of Augusta, Maine. It offers a quiet, suburban feel with convenient access to the city's amenities and major routes like I-95.

Housing & Real Estate

The housing market in Polands Corner features a mix of single-family homes, many on spacious lots. The median home value is approximately $169,800, making it an affordable option within the Augusta area.

Schools & Education

Families are served by the Augusta School Department, with students typically attending Farrington Elementary School and Cony High School. The neighborhood's location also provides access to nearby private school options.

Parks & Recreation

Residents enjoy proximity to outdoor spaces like the Kennebec River Rail Trail for walking and biking. The Augusta City Center and the State House grounds are also a short drive away for community events.

Local Dining & Shopping

While primarily residential, the neighborhood is just minutes from Augusta's commercial hubs like Western Avenue and Civic Center Drive. Here, residents find a variety of restaurants, grocery stores, and retail shops.

Who Lives Here

The area is home to a mix of families, professionals, and long-time residents. With a median household income around $61,583, it represents a stable, middle-class community within the state capital region.
